Summary: | Rheumatism is a disease that attacks the joints and surrounding areas which includes
osteoarthritis, rheumatoid arthrtis and gout. Gout or often called uric acid disease is rheumatic
disease that affects many people. Gout is a condition where there is an increase in uric acid levels
above normal, causing a buildup of uric acid. Pirdot (Saurauia bracteosa DC.) and remason
(Polygala paniculata L.) are plants that people traditionally use to treat gout. Tests were carried
out to prove the potential of pirdot and remason to treat gout by testing the inhibitory activity of
xanthine oxidase ethanol extract and water extract of both plants. The inhibition of xanthine
oxidase activity was measured based on the level of uric acid formed in the reaction of the
xanthine substrate with the xanthine oxidase enzyme, compared to the reaction of xanthine
substrate, xanthine oxidase enzyme and addition of sample then measured by UV visible
spectrophotometer at 290 nm wavelength. The test results showed that remason ethanol extract
had the highest inhibitory activity of xanthine oxidase with IC??at 504,84 ± 5,06 µg/ml. While IC??
of pirdot ethanol extract was obtained at 533,64 ± 4,37 µg/ml, IC??of pirdot water extract was
1.341,87 ± 14,70 µg/ml and IC??of remason water extract was 1.060,71 ± 9,57 µg/ml. Remason
ethanol extract which had the highest activity was fractionated using n-hexane, ethyl acetate and
water solvent and then tested the xanthine oxidase inhibition activity. Ethyl acetate fraction of
remason showed the highest activity with IC??at 175,65 ± 3,11 µg/ml. The results of
phytochemical screening and TLC showed that remason ethanol extract and remason ethyl
acetate fraction contains flavonoids which can provide xanthine oxidase inhibitory activity.
